Nano showcased at Cooper-Hewitt National Design museum
Tata Nano will soon be showcased in the Cooper-Hewitt, National Design Museum, New York, USA from February 18 to April 25, 2010. Tata launched Nano in India last year and termed it 'the people's car'. Since its conception, Nano has generated a lot of curiosity across the world. As a testimony to that a bright sunshine yellow Nano would be on display in Cooper-Hewitt's Great Hall, along with diagrams and a short film describing its concept, development and production. The curatorial director of the museum Cara McCarty said, "Cooper-Hewitt's mission is to present the very latest developments in design and technology and the Tata Nano introduces more families in India to the new world of affordable and safer mobility. We're eager to display the Tata Nano at the museum, where many visitors will see it for the first time."
Tata Nano is continuing the 'affordable motoring' tradition where its predecessors Henry Ford's Model T, the Volkswagen Beetle, Citroen 2CV and the original Fiat 500 left it. With Nano Ratan Tata has tried to provide an affordable family vehicle other than a motorbike or a scooter. Nano pollutes less and offers a fuel efficiency of 21.2kmpl. The car was designed by 500 Indian engineers and Tata Motors is keenly developing newer versions of the car for European and American markets.
The car has very basic features and is stripped down to the essentials. This 35-horsepower engine, four-door vehicle is about 10 feet long, weighs approximately 1,300 pounds, has an all-sheet-metal body, a rear two-cylinder engine, small tubeless tires, a reinforced passenger compartment, crumple zones, seat belts and achieves a top speed of 106kmph. However, safety has been a concern in the minds of many. But Tata Nano passed a roll-over test and offset impact test and put some fears to rest. But the car still does not include a power steering, air bags, antilock brakes or an exterior left passenger-side mirror.
